Abstract

The invention provides an inside-incinerator flue gas furnace denitrification apparatus, which comprises an incinerator, a flue gas online monitoring control device, a cloth bag dust removing device, a fan and a chimney, and is characterized in that the incinerator is sequentially connected to the flue gas online monitoring control device, the cloth bag dust removing device, the fan and the chimney, the flue gas online monitoring control device is connected to a PLC control box, the PLC control box is connected to a frequency conversion rotary feeder, an electronic spiral scale is connected above the frequency conversion rotary feeder and is connected to a material unloading device, the material unloading device is connected to a urea particle bin, the upper portion of a jet flow mixer is connected below the frequency conversion rotary feeder, one side surface of the jet flow mixer is connected to a water inlet electromagnetic valve and a water inlet through a water inlet pipeline, the lower portion of the jet flow mixer is connected to a dissolving box, one side on the top portion of the dissolving box is provided with a water inlet flow rate meter, and the water inlet flow rate meter is connected to the water inlet electromagnetic valve and the water inlet through a water inlet pipeline. According to the present invention, with the inside-incinerator flue gas furnace denitrification apparatus, nitrogen oxide and other harmful pollutants in the incinerator flue gas can be removed, the flue gas can achieve the discharge standard, and the environmental pollution can be avoided.

Description

technical field [0001] The invention relates to an incinerator flue gas denitrification device, specifically for purifying the flue gas produced by domestic garbage incinerators, and belongs to the technical field of environmental protection. Background technique [0002] In the existing technology, the flue gas between 850 ° C and 1100 ° C generated after the domestic waste is fully incinerated, the denitrification process mainly uses ammonia water (or urea solution) as the reducing agent, using manual feeding, and the degree of automation of the device is not high. , can not meet the continuous demand for chemicals in the removal of nitrogen oxides in large flue gas volumes, resulting in waste of manpower and material resources; there is no flue gas online monitoring and control device, and the doses of chemicals are randomly added, which cannot be monitored in real time and cannot ensure a good denitrification effect. The waste is serious and the operating cost is high. ...
